Output 621ea6720ddc261e4524cd0d52c63efecaaef4ea11a2c288665967718f69d3ec: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55655fb6dcfec147c67118d9fd421da0da1e7f58 OP_EQUAL
address
MFgh7KKh6kzgtqMNXUp9NEM2DgphjAQbMU
transaction
621ea6720ddc261e4524cd0d52c63efecaaef4ea11a2c288665967718f69d3ec
spent
true